摘  要:目的探讨老龄宿主并发铜绿假单胞菌(P.Aeruginosa,PA)肺部感染时肺组织局部炎症细胞浸润及中性粒细胞趋化物(cytokine-induced neutrophil chemoattractants,CINC)、单核细胞趋化蛋白-1(monocyte chemoattractant protein-1,MCP-1)表达的动态变化及意义,进而探讨增龄对肺局部趋化因子表达情况的影响。方法清洁级SD大鼠(青年组/老年组)气管接种PA建立肺部感染模型,分别取不同时间段(0、2、6、9、12、24 h)肺组织、肺泡灌洗液及心脏采血,行细菌学检测、病理学检测、全血白细胞分类计数,并采用实时荧光定量-聚合酶链反应(real time-polymerase chain reaction,RT-PCR),从基因转录水平研究PA肺部感染大鼠模型肺组织中CINC、MCP-1的表达。结果成功建模后,(1)老年组较青年组一般表现严重;(2)肺组织病理检查:青年组病变局限,炎症反应明显,肺组织结构破坏相对轻微;老年组病变弥散,炎症反应较轻,肺组织水肿、出血较多(2~12 h明显),相应时间点,肺组织中PMN、单核/巨噬细胞数少于青年组(P<0.05,24 h单核/巨噬细胞浸润数量差别无统计学意义);(3)接种PA后,两组大鼠CINCmRNA、MCP-1mRNA表达均增加,老年组峰值滞后于青年组。结论增龄能够减弱肺局部CINC、MCP-1趋化因子基因表达,进而下调CINC、MCP-1诱导的中性粒细胞及单核/巨噬细胞聚集,后者可能是导致老龄肺炎危险性增高的原因之一。Objective To investigate the dynamic changes cytokine-induced neutrophil chemoattrac- tants (CINC) mRNA and monocyte chemoattractant protein-1 (MCP-1) mRNA expression in old rats with pulmonary infection of P. Aeruginosa (PA). Methods Sixty-eight male SD rats were divided into two groups: old group and young group. PA pulmonary infection model was induced by inoculation of bacteria into rat trachea. Lung tissue, bronchoalveolar lavage fluid and blood samples were collected at 0 h, 2 h, 6 h, 9 h, 12 h and 24 h. The expression of CINC mRNA and MCP-1 mRNA were detected by RT-PCR method. Results The general condition and manifestation were serious in old rats with PA lung infection than in young rats. Pathological examinations demonstrated that in lung tissue of young rats the inflammatory reaction was predominant and lung tissue structure damage was relatively mild; in the old rats the lung lesions were dispersion, inflammatory reaction was lighter, lung tissue edema and bleeding existed and more marked at 2 - 12 h samples. The infiltration of mononuclear cells and macrophages in lung tissue of old group was less than that in young group ( P 〈 0.05 ), but there was no difference between two groups at 24 h ( P 〉 0.05 ). The expression of CINC mRNA and MCP-1 mRNA was increased after PA inoculation, but peak value of old group lagged behind the young group. Conclusion Aging can weaken the expression of CINC mRNA and MCP-1 mRNA in lung tissue, thus reduce the infiltration of neutrophil and monocyte-macrophages, which may lead to increased risk of pneumonia in elderly patient.
